Lumin Skincare and Grooming Products Review

Lumin Skincare and Grooming Products Review

Posted on October 2, 2020October 2, 2020 By Drew

Heres’ my problem with having combination skin. Too many cleansers either strip away every so that all I’m left with is a face that feels like I just stared at the open ark of the covenant or they are too gentle which leads to breakouts which I’m trying to avoid in the first place. Lumin Skincare is looking to walk the tightrope of the middle ground and offer a face wash that cleans deep and into pores without stripping all of my natural skin oils. Recently the good folks at Lumin sent me some samples of their grooming products to try out and see if they could actually live up to the task. I’ve decided to divide this review up into two parts. First, I want to talk about the skincare portion of Lumin’s line, and then I’ll get into the grooming products. 

Lumin Skincare Products Review

First and foremost, we have to talk about the charcoal face wash. I have reviewed charcoal face washes in the past, and have not always had the best of luck with them. They clean well, but I have found my skin responds better to salicylic acid. The Lumin charcoal cleanser is stronger than others I have tried in the past and I did have better results. What I found was that this cleanser really works best if you commit to it. No days off. No nights where you say you’re too tired to wash your face. I think it is quite suitable for almost all skin types, but I think adding something with salicylic acid during the week wouldn’t be a bad idea.

The moisturizer is excellent. It’s light and absorbs quickly. After I’ve applied it, my skin feels supple, but, at the same time, protected. Moisturizing is an important part of any skincare regimen. Unfortunately, I think too many men neglect this step. This moisturizer is a great way to get in the habit.

The eye gel is truly a great product. I’ve always had concerns about dark circles around my eyes, and that’s only been compounded by lack of sleep from stress while quarantining and homeschooling. I absolutely noticed a brightening of the skin around my eyes using this product. I’ve tried a good number of eye products over the years, and I think this one did a great job of brightening my eyes the next morning. The trick was to use very little. It’s a little runnier than others. So if you want to avoid sliming up your pillow case, go light and add more if necessary.

I think the face scrub was my least favorite product I tried. I personally prefer scrubs that are thicker and have some abrasiveness. Since I use them less frequently, I want a scrub that gets in there and exfoliates. I found this scrub to be thinner and more mild than I prefer. 

Lumin Grooming Products Review

Now let’s move on to the hair and body products from Lumin. The shampoo and conditioner were excellent. My hair felt softer and cleaner after using them for just a few days. More importantly, my hair did not feel stripped or dry at all. Some cleansers will remove all the good oils your hair needs too for the sake of “cleaning it”. This was certainly not the case with Lumin’s shampoo and conditioner.

For me, the best product I tried in this collection was the scalp treatment. It was refreshing and revitalizing. My scalp felt cleaner and I honestly think it helped my hair feel better too. I absolutely recommend this product. Unfortunately, the same could not be said for the body wash. I found it difficult to lather, and it seemed generally thin to me. Not my something I would recommend using.

Overall, I was very pleased with the performance of Lumin’s skincare and grooming products. I’m so thankful they let me try so many out. It’s important to remember that skincare products are highly personal. What works for me, might not work for you, and vice versa. If I had to cherry pick a few to try initially, I would suggest the face wash, scalp treatment, and moisturizer. Please feel free to hit me up with any follow up questions.
